Master the Art of Metal Detecting with Essential Pinpointers: A Comprehensive Guide

Pinpointers are essential tools for any metal detecting enthusiast, especially beginners. They help locate the exact position of a target within a hole or in the ground, making the retrieval process quicker and more efficient. In this comprehensive guide, we will discuss various aspects of pinpointers to help you make an informed decision when choosing one and how to effectively use it.
**Types of Pinpointers: Probe vs. Pinpointer**
When it comes to pinpointing tools, there are two main types: probes and pinpointers. Probes are long, thin rods that you insert into the ground to locate a target by physically feeling for it. Pinpointers, on the other hand, are handheld devices that use electromagnetic fields to detect metal objects without direct contact.
While probes can be effective in certain situations, pinpointers are generally more user-friendly and efficient for beginners. They provide audio and/or vibration feedback when near a target, making them easier to use, especially for those new to metal detecting.
**Choosing the Best Pinpointer for Beginners**
For beginners looking to invest in their first pinpointer, some key features to consider include:
– Durability: Look for a sturdy construction that can withstand outdoor conditions.
– Sensitivity: A good sensitivity range will ensure you don’t miss small targets.
– Waterproofing: If you plan on beach hunting or detecting in wet conditions, opt for a waterproof model.
– Ease of Use: Choose a user-friendly model with intuitive controls.
– Price: Consider your budget and choose a pinpointer that offers value for money.
Popular brands like Garrett and Minelab offer reliable pinpointers suitable for beginners with varying features and price points.

**Waterproof Pinpointers for Beach Hunting**
Beach hunting is popular among treasure hunters due to the potential of finding lost jewelry and coins in sandy areas near water bodies. For beach hunting enthusiasts, investing in a waterproof pinpointer is essential as it allows you to search in shallow water or wet sand without worrying about damage.
Waterproof models like the Garrett Pro-Pointer AT or Minelab Pro-Find 35 offer excellent performance both on land and underwater up to certain depths.
**Essential Accessories You Need**
To enhance your pinpointing experience, consider investing in accessories such as:
– Holsters or sheaths: Keep your pinpointer secure while detecting
– Lanyards: Prevent accidental drops or loss of your device
– Replacement tips: Ensure longevity by having spare tips handy
These accessories not only protect your investment but also improve usability during hunts.
